How to Implement an Enterprise AI Video Generation Platform 2026

Implementing a video generation strategy requires more than just a subscription; it requires a structured approach to data security and brand alignment. Follow these steps to integrate a platform into your 2026 corporate workflow:

  1. Audit Visual Identity: Define your brand’s "style DNA" by feeding existing high-quality video assets into the platform’s fine-tuning module to ensure consistent character and color grading.
  2. API Integration: Connect your platform to your data sources. For example, using the Seedance 2.0 API on fal allows your developers to trigger video generation directly from product inventory updates or news feeds.
  3. Establish Governance: Set up permission tiers for who can generate and approve content, ensuring that all AI-generated output passes through a human-in-the-loop (HITL) review process for high-stakes campaigns.
  4. Automate Localization: Utilize the platform’s built-in translation and lip-sync features to adapt a single master video for global markets in minutes, rather than weeks.
  5. Monitor Performance: Use the platform's analytics dashboard to track engagement metrics and iterate on prompts to improve the ROI of your generated content.

Brand Safety and Ethical Compliance

In 2026, ethical AI is no longer optional. Enterprise platforms now include built-in "Content Credentials" (C2PA) and digital watermarking to prove the provenance of the video. This protects organizations from deepfake allegations and ensures compliance with global AI regulations. Furthermore, platforms are now trained on licensed or proprietary datasets, mitigating the copyright risks that plagued earlier iterations of generative AI. Future Trends: What to Expect Post-2026

The trajectory of AI video suggests that we are moving toward "interactive video" where the viewer can influence the narrative in real-time. While we are seeing the early stages of this in 2026, the next step for enterprise platforms will be the integration of real-time 3D (RT3D) engines with generative video. This will allow for immersive virtual reality (VR) training environments that are generated on-the-fly based on the trainee's performance.

Furthermore, the convergence of AI video and "Digital Twins" is becoming more prominent. Enterprises are creating digital replicas of their spokespeople, allowing them to record a single session and then generate thousands of localized videos in different languages and outfits. This level of personalization was unthinkable just a few years ago but is now a standard feature in high-end enterprise suites. As these technologies continue to evolve, the distinction between "filmed" and "generated" content will continue to blur, making transparency and ethics more important than ever.
